Charging the Flynova Pro
Before your maiden voyage, fully charging your Flynova Pro is crucial for optimal performance. Locate the charging port, typically found on the sphere’s underside. Connect the included USB charging cable to the port and a suitable power source – a computer USB port, a wall adapter, or a portable power bank will all work.
During charging, you’ll likely observe an LED indicator illuminating, signaling the charging process. The color and blinking pattern of this LED will vary depending on the charging status (see the ‘LED Indicator Meanings’ section for details). Expect a full charge to take approximately 30-60 minutes, though this can vary.
Avoid overcharging the device, as this could potentially impact battery life. Once fully charged, the LED indicator will typically change color or turn off entirely. Disconnect the charging cable and prepare for flight! Always ensure the charging port is clean and free of debris before connecting the cable.

Understanding the Control Methods
The Flynova Pro primarily utilizes hand gesture control, making it uniquely intuitive. Unlike traditional drones with remote controllers, you interact with the Pro by simply using your hands. Specific gestures dictate different actions – throwing, pushing, pulling, and rotating motions all translate into flight commands.

Throwing initiates flight, while gentle pushes and pulls control direction. Rotating your hand while the device is airborne allows for spinning maneuvers. Mastering these gestures takes practice, but the learning curve is relatively gentle. The device’s internal sensors accurately interpret your movements, providing responsive control.
Some models may offer limited app-based control for advanced settings or calibration. However, the core experience revolves around intuitive hand gestures. Experiment with different motions to discover the full range of control possibilities. Remember to practice in an open space to avoid collisions during the learning process.

Battery Life and Replacement
Maximizing your Flynova Pro’s flight time requires understanding its battery capabilities. Expect approximately 8-10 minutes of flight per full charge, though this can vary based on flying style and environmental conditions. Aggressive maneuvers and strong winds will naturally reduce battery life.
To prolong battery health, avoid overcharging and completely discharging the device. Store the Flynova Pro in a cool, dry place when not in use. When the battery begins to degrade – indicated by significantly reduced flight times – it’s time for a replacement.
Replacing the battery requires careful handling; Always use a genuine Flynova Pro replacement battery to ensure compatibility and safety. Follow the manufacturer’s instructions precisely during the replacement process. Caution: Improper battery handling can be hazardous. Seek professional assistance if you’re unsure about any step.
